Audi Shark Hovercar Concept

A designer named Kazim Doku has won first prize in the Desire Design Competition launched in 2008 by the Italian Domus Academy for his amazing Audi Shark hovercar concept (above). The futuristic two-seater flying sportscar is inspired by both motorcycle and jet design, for maximum performance as well as safety. The name of course comes from its resemblance to a gray reef shark. Its streamlined design, sharp nose and fin-like rear lower spoiler contribute to the vehicle's "underwater" appearance. Both the headlights and taillights are made by transparent tubes which integrate LED units, while the somewhat cramped interior features sport seats integrated in the cockpit structure.
